Location: Eastern Chhattisgarh, on the banks of the Hasdeo River
District: Korba
Significance: Known as the "Power Capital of Chhattisgarh" due to its large coal mining and power generation industries
Industry & Economy
Power Generation: Korba is home to several thermal power plants, including the Korba Super Thermal Power Station and other major plants, contributing significantly to India's power supply
Coal Mining: The region has large coal reserves, and coal mining is a major industry, with several mining projects in the area
Agriculture: While industrial growth is dominant, the region also produces rice, maize, and sugarcane
Industry Growth: Apart from power generation, Korba is also witnessing growth in manufacturing and heavy industries

Climate
Type: Tropical wet and dry climate
Summer: Hot and dry (30–45°C)
Winter: Mild and cool (10–25°C)
Best Time to Visit: October to March, when the weather is comfortable for outdoor activities
